Pros & cons summary
| Performance score | 0.41 | 0.33 |
| Recency | 1 January 2009 | 1 November 2009 |
| Power consumption (TDP) | 35 Watt | 20 Watt |
Turion X2 RM-74 has a 24.2% higher aggregate performance score.
Athlon 64 X2 TK-42, on the other hand, has an age advantage of 10 months, and 75% lower power consumption.
The AMD Turion X2 RM-74 is our recommended choice as it beats the AMD Athlon 64 X2 TK-42 in performance tests.
